About the role

Working closely with the Director of Engineering and Project Director, the Quality Manager will be responsible for maintaining neo-bionica's quality performance through the effective implementation, maintenance and continual improvement of the Quality Management System (QMS), ensuring efficient and compliant application of QMS requirements across new and existing client development projects, manufacturing activities and business operations. This is a hands-on role requiring a proactive individual who takes ownership of quality management activities, ensures compliance with ISO 13485 and applicable regulatory requirements, and works collaboratively with project, engineering, manufacturing and operational teams.

The Quality

Manager will report to neo-bionica's CEO.

Key responsibilities

- Create, maintain, and improve Qualio templates in line with business needs and QMS requirements
- Guide document owners in creating, updating, reviewing and approving relevant documentation
- Maintain document and record control, including hardcopy quality records, revision control for projects, documentation and materials, and applicable regulatory record requirements
- Create and maintain training plans, provide QMS training as required, and conduct quality inductions for new staff members
- Review and approve materials, equipment, service activities, device assembly records and batch records
- Conduct supplier assessments, maintain the approved supplier list, and perform site and supplier audits as required




- Participate in risk management activities and support establishment and maintenance of risk management files
- Drive nonconformance investigations with the NC owner and own or action audit finding NCs and corrective and preventive actions
- Collate quality metrics for input into management review meetings
- Manage and participate in internal and external audits, including hosting external audits where required

About you

- Experience working in a certified ISO 13485 workplace
- Thorough knowledge of ISO 13485 and FDA 21 CFR Part 820
- Experience administering or maintaining an electronic QMS, preferably Qualio
- Strong attention to detail and excellent documentation skills
- Ability to contribute at both strategic/management and hands-on execution levels
- Team player with excellent interpersonal and communication skills
- Understanding of medical device development and regulatory pathways (preferred)
- Knowledge of manufacturing establishment (preferred)
- Knowledge of EN 45502-1 and ISO 14971 standards (preferred)
- Experience with design and/or manufacturing of class III implantable medical devices (preferred)
- Minimum 5 years' experience

About us neo-bionica is a pioneering product development and contract manufacturing company specialising in neurotechnology, headquartered in Australia. Our mission is to partner in developing cutting-edge medical devices that improve the quality of life for individuals with neurological conditions. We are committed to innovation, excellence, and transforming healthcare through advanced technology.
